What is handling strategy in SAP BC-ESI - Enterprise Service Infrastructure?


SAP Term: handling strategy

  • Component: BC-ESI

  • Component Name: Enterprise Service Infrastructure

  • Description: Specifies the method used to handle errors. The process agent framework supports the following handling strategies: Manual error handling with standard user interface Manual error handling with application-specific user interface Automatic rejection Automatic notification and reconciliation message requested Automatic retry The manual handling strategies involve a user in error handling at runtime, as well as the system.
